Technical and further education (TAFE) lecturers teach vocational courses connected with industries and areas of work, to help people enter or re-enter the workforce.

TAFE lecturers teach subjects in which they have specialist knowledge and experience, such as building and construction, business and commerce, commercial photography, hairdressing, horticulture, hospitality and tourism, music, art, science, engineering and areas of health. Some TAFE lecturers teach in non-industry specific areas such as languages, literacy and general workplace preparation.

TAFE lecturers may teach courses during the day, at night and on weekends.

TAFE lecturers need to constantly revise their own knowledge of their subject area and conduct industry and student surveys to ensure that course content and teaching methods are up to date.
